Richard001 Posted December 31, 2022 Share Posted December 31, 2022 Hello All, and a happy new year,I have noticed that over time my white Scalextric cars turn Berge. Perhaps it's the aging of the clear coat. Is there anything that can be done to restore the white areas while preserving the "decals"?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
Andy P. Posted January 1, 2023 Share Posted January 1, 2023 Hi Richard,I am no expert but all I have seen basically says soaking in hydrogen peroxide in strong sunlight over several hours (days) will help get the white back BUT there is a strong chance the decals will not survive....
